在部署韩国游戏原生IP用于跨服对战与账号管理时,最佳实践需要在性能、合规与成本三方面取得平衡。最好(最稳定)的方案通常是多活数据中心 + 全球CDN + 专用网连接,以保证低延迟和高可用;最佳(性价比最高)的方案是基于容器化的微服务架构、自动扩缩容和托管数据库组合;而最便宜的方案则可采用云厂商的预留实例、Spot实例与Serverless函数,将非实时任务下沉以降低费用。本文围绕服务器层面进行详尽评测与实战说明。
对于承载韩国游戏原生IP的服务器架构,推荐采用分层设计:网关层(L4/L7负载均衡)、会话层(Auth & Session Service)、对战层(Matchmaking & Game Servers)、持久层(关系型/分布式数据库)、缓存与消息队列层(Redis、Kafka/RabbitMQ)。这种分层便于独立扩展、故障隔离与版本迭代。
跨服对战对网络实时性要求极高,需在服务器上实现UDP/TCP混合传输、基于Region的Matchmaking算法、并使用专门的穿透与中继服务器来处理不同网络环境下的连接问题。建议使用UDP为主的游戏逻辑通道,TCP/HTTP仅用于回放、排行榜与补偿数据同步。
账号管理应拆分为独立的Auth Service,支持第三方登录(例如Naver、Kakao、Apple)以及自研账号体系。服务器端需实现Token机制(JWT或短期Token+Refresh),并对敏感操作启用二次校验与异常行为审计。账号数据要加密存储并保障可追溯的审计日志。
跨服场景下,排行榜、货币与好友关系等数据需保证最终一致性。推荐采用事件驱动架构(Event Sourcing)和幂等消费设计,使用消息队列协调跨服务更新,避免强一致分布式事务带来的性能瓶颈。
采用Kubernetes进行容器编排,配合Horizontal Pod Autoscaler根据CPU/网络/自定义指标自动扩缩容。对战服务器可采用本地多线程/协程模型提升每节点并发能力,同时通过NAT/Anycast等技术优化跨区域路由。
要实现良好的跨服对战体验,必须在服务器侧优化延迟:部署多活节点于韩国、日本、东南亚等关键区域,使用专线或云厂商的加速产品(如AWS Global Accelerator、Azure Front Door或本地厂商加速)。此外,使用网络丢包补偿与客户端预测也能提升感受。
服务器应集成DDoS防护、WAF与行为分析系统,使用机器学习或规则引擎识别作弊。关键游戏逻辑放在可信服务器端执行,客户端仅作输入采集与渲染,防止重要规则被篡改。
要达到“最便宜”又能满足体验的目标,可以将非实时服务迁移至Serverless或低成本实例,实时对战服务器使用预留/Spot组合降低成本。推荐使用基础监控(Prometheus+Grafana)、自动化部署(CI/CD)和基础设施即代码(Terraform)来减少运维成本。
作为韩国游戏原生IP的部署,需要注意地域法律、玩家隐私保护与版权管理。服务器应支持数据主权策略、敏感数据脱敏与按需访问控制,同时通过代码混淆、内容签名与水印等手段保护IP资产。
实时监控玩家连接数、延迟分布、丢包率与后端队列积压,建立熔断与降级策略。建议定期演练灾难恢复(DR)计划,启用跨可用区/跨区域备份与冷备/热备结合的策略。
某韩国MMO将原生IP部署到亚太多区域,采用Kubernetes + Helm部署控制平面,Matchmaking Service放到靠近玩家的区域节点,会话信息写入分片Redis并异步同步至中心数据库。通过部署中继服务器解决跨NAT/跨国连接问题,并用消息队列处理虚拟货币流水,实现高并发下的事务最终一致性。
经过多轮压力测试,该方案在8个区域峰值同时在线50万玩家时,平均延迟落在80-150ms区间,丢包率可控且系统无单点崩溃。成本方面,通过Spot实例与自动缩容,在线稳定期整体云成本比传统预留实例方案降低约30%。
建议优先做好核心Auth与Matchmaking的容错与观测,再逐步迁移为全自动化微服务。未来可引入边缘计算节点优化最后一公里延迟,并通过智能调度进一步平衡跨区域玩家体验与成本。
部署韩国游戏原生IP于跨服对战与账号管理,核心在于架构分层、网络优化、数据一致性与成本控制。通过容器化、多活节点、事件驱动与严格的安全策略,可以在保证体验的同时将成本压到合理区间,实战案例也证明了该路径的可行性。